How to Vet Unknown Numbers
- Don’t answer right away: Let it ring. If it’s important, they’ll leave a message.
- Use a reverse lookup tool: Sites like Whitepages, Truecaller, or even Google can give you some context.
- Listen to voicemails carefully: Real organizations leave complete and clear messages stating who they are, why they’re calling, and how to get back in touch.
If a caller listens to your voicemail greeting and immediately hangs up, send that one straight to spam.
Why Do Some Numbers Keep Calling?
If you’ve gotten multiple rings from 6175170000, you’re not alone. Recurring calls from unfamiliar numbers are a tactic used by both legitimate businesses and shady operators. The goal is simple: wear you down so you pick up. If you do answer and it’s a pitch or vague conversation starter, that’s a trick to engage you. Politely ask for identifying info or hang up.
Automated dialers can also mask the origin of a call, so the same spam operation could be bouncing across different numbers, including this one.

What to Do If You Answered?
So you picked up. Don’t panic. Here’s what to do:
If you feel something’s off, just hang up. You owe no one your time. If you accidentally shared personal info (like last 4 digits of your SSN or school info), monitor your credit and accounts for any unusual activity. Report suspicious behavior to the FTC or your mobile carrier.
Simple steps now can save you a mess later.
How to Block 6175170000
Most smartphones make this easy:
On iPhone: Tap the ‘i’ icon next to the number → scroll down → tap “Block this Caller.” On Android: Tap and hold the number in your call log → tap “Block/report spam.”
Blocking just cuts the line to that one number, though. For broader protection, consider installing apps like Hiya, RoboKiller, or Nomorobo that catch robocalls before they ring through.
